  • Architectural/Civil Engineering: Cladding, handrails, door and window fittings, street furniture, structural sections, enforcement bar, lighting columns, lintels, masonry supports.

  •  Transport: Exhaust systems, car trim/grilles, road tankers, ship containers, ships chemical tankers, refuse vehicles.

  •  Chemical/Pharmaceutical: Pressure vessels, process piping.

  •  Oil and gas: Platform accommodation, cable trays, sub-sea pipelines.

  •  Medical: Surgical instruments, surgical implants, food processing.

  •  Food and Drink: Catering equipment, brewing, distilling, food processing.

  •  Water: Water and sewage treatment, water tubing, hot water tanks.

  •  General: Springs, fasteners(bolts, nuts and washers) wire.

Q: What is the specific heat capacity of stainless steel sheets?
The specific heat capacity of stainless steel sheets may differ based on the specific grade and composition of the stainless steel. Nevertheless, the average specific heat capacity of stainless steel is approximately 500 J/kg°C. Hence, to increase the temperature of one kilogram of stainless steel by 1 degree Celsius, it would necessitate 500 joules of energy. It is crucial to acknowledge that this measurement may not be universally applicable to all varieties of stainless steel. Therefore, it is advisable to seek guidance from specific technical data or reference materials for precise and reliable values.

Q: What are the common uses of stainless steel sheets in the automotive industry?
Due to their unique properties and characteristics, stainless steel sheets have numerous applications in the automotive industry. Below are some common uses of stainless steel sheets in this industry: 1. Exhaust Systems: Stainless steel sheets are extensively utilized in the manufacturing of vehicle exhaust systems. The high-temperature resistance, corrosion resistance, and durability of stainless steel make it an ideal choice for this application. 2. Body Panels: Stainless steel sheets are commonly employed for producing body panels, including fenders, hoods, and doors. The strength, impact resistance, and aesthetic appeal of stainless steel make it a popular material for enhancing the durability and appearance of vehicles. 3. Structural Components: Various structural components in automotive applications are fabricated using stainless steel sheets. These components may include chassis, brackets, reinforcements, and frame parts. Stainless steel's high strength-to-weight ratio and excellent mechanical properties make it suitable for enhancing the overall stability and strength of the vehicle. 4. Fuel Tanks: Stainless steel sheets are frequently used for manufacturing fuel tanks in automobiles. The resistance of stainless steel to corrosion, especially against chemicals present in fuels, ensures long-lasting and leak-free fuel storage. 5. Heat Shields: Stainless steel sheets are utilized in the production of heat shields to protect sensitive components from excessive heat generated by the engine or exhaust system. Stainless steel's excellent thermal conductivity and resistance to high temperatures make it an ideal material for this purpose. 6. Fasteners and Clamps: Various fasteners, clamps, and brackets in automotive applications are manufactured using stainless steel sheets. These components require high strength, corrosion resistance, and durability, which stainless steel provides. 7. Trim and Decorative Accents: Stainless steel sheets are often used for trim and decorative accents in vehicles. The aesthetic appeal, shine, and corrosion resistance of stainless steel add elegance and durability to the vehicle's interior and exterior. In conclusion, stainless steel sheets have a wide range of applications in the automotive industry, including exhaust systems, body panels, structural components, fuel tanks, heat shields, fasteners, clamps, and trim. The unique properties of stainless steel, such as corrosion resistance, high strength, durability, and aesthetic appeal, make it a preferred material for various automotive applications.

Q: What is called anti fingerprint stainless steel sheet?
Anti fingerprint (also known as non fingerprint) stainless steel plate is a protective layer treatment process is extremely thin and solid formed on the surface of stainless steel by nano coating technology, the stainless steel surface can not only achieve the anti fingerprint effect, but also can improve the ability of anti corrosion; and processing, such as bending or stamping processing can meet the general request.
Q: Can stainless steel sheets be used for cryogenic storage containers?
Yes, stainless steel sheets can be used for cryogenic storage containers. Stainless steel is known for its excellent strength, durability, and resistance to corrosion, which makes it well-suited for cryogenic applications. Additionally, stainless steel has a low thermal conductivity, which helps to minimize heat transfer from the surroundings to the stored contents. This property is crucial in cryogenic storage to maintain the low temperatures required for the preservation of materials such as liquefied gases or biological samples. Overall, stainless steel sheets are a reliable and commonly used material for cryogenic storage containers.
